Prime Minister Left Kathmandu For New York

Issue 39, September 27, 2009


BY KTM Metro Reporter in Kathmandu

On September 20, 2009, Prime Minister Madhav Nepal has left Kathmandu for New York for participating in the 64th General Assembly of the UN. He is going to address the General Assembly on September 23, 2009, and the International Health Partnership on September 24, 2009. He will be back home on September 28, 2009. The Prime Minister and his spouse will celebrate the Dashain festival in New York, and will be back just on time to receive ‘tika’ (blessing) from the ceremonial President.

This time, Foreign Minister Sujata Koirala has not fallen sick, so she has joined the Prime Minister’s entourage to visit New York but she has taken a different flight to New York. The entourage of the Prime Minister has the number of legislators, Health Minister, Secretaries to the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and the Ministry of Health, advisors to the Prime Minister on political matters and foreign affairs, and last but not the least one: spouse of the Prime Minister.
